CLI Configuration
Node
Command
Description
enable
show access-list
This command displays all of the
access control profiles.
configure
access-list STRING iptype
(ipv4|ipv6)
This command creates a new access
control profile.
Where the STRING is the profile
name. And you can specify the
type, ipv4 or ipv6.
configure
no access-list STRING
This command deletes an access
control profile.
acl
show
This command displays the current
access control profile.
acl
action (disable|drop|permit)
This command actives this profile.
disable – disable the profile.
drop – If packets match the profile,
the packets will be dropped.
permit – If packets match the
profile, the packets will be
forwarded.
acl
action dscp remarking <0-63>
This command actives this profile
and specify that it is for DSCP
remark. And configures the new
DSCP value which will be override
to all packets matched this profile.
acl
action 802.1p remarking <0-7>
This command actives this profile
and specify that it is for 802.1p
remark. And configures the new
802.1p value which will be override
to all packets matched this profile.
acl
802.1p VALUE
This command configures the
802.1p value for the profile.
acl
dscp VALUE
This command configures the DSCP
value for the profile.
acl
destination mac host MACADDR
This command configures the
destination MAC and mask for the
profile.
acl
destination mac MACADDR
MACADDR
This command configures the
destination MAC and mask for the
profile.
acl
destination mac MACADDR
MACADDR
This command configures the
destination
MAC and mask for the profile. The
second MACADDR parameter is the
mask for the profile.
acl
no destination mac
This command removes the
destination MAC from the profile.
acl
ethertype STRING
This command configures the ether
type for the profile. Where the
STRING is a hexdecimal value. e.g.:
08AA.
acl
no ethertype
This command removes the
limitation of the ether type from
the profile.
acl
source mac host MACADDR
This command configures the
source MAC and mask for the
profile.
acl
source mac MACADDR
MACADDR
This command configures the
source AMC and mask for the
profile.
acl
no source mac
This command removes the source
MAC and mask from the profile.
acl
source ip host IPADDR
This command configures the
source IP address for the profile.
